The History of Carbon Fiber TechnologyCarbon fiber material was developed for use in the defense and aerospace industry and is the strongest material known to man. Unlike metals, carbon fiber composites do not fatigue or weaken and can be wound, braided, wrapped, layered or uniquely tailored to provide exacting safety and performance characteristics. When properly designed and configured, carbon fiber composites offer unique benefits for structural applications in the next generation of sports equipment. This new generation of revolutionary equipment will be lighter than aluminum but with the strength, stiffness, and durability of steel. Most important of all, these lightweight designs will greatly improve safety and convenience for all players, coaches, and staff members who must regularly struggle with their outdated equipment. In fact, world-class coaches and athletes in other sports have already embraced the use of carbon fiber equipment to establish new performance standards in golf, tennis, sailing, wind surfing, ice hockey, lacrosse, rowing, kayaking, bicycle racing, motorcycle racing, and auto racing. Unfortunately, volleyball net and post systems have been frozen in time. The 1970s designed steel uprights are dangerously heavy to transport and set up. Most newer lightweight aluminum designs, regardless of how they are configured, will bend and deform in use. Although carbon fiber uprights won't necessarily improve a team's performance on the court, it will make the task of setting up the court much safer, easier, and more convenient.
